Comparison review

LG G Pad X 8.3 has a score of 63.8, which is a bit better than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E's 61.7 score. Both of these tablets use Android OS (Operating System), but LG G Pad X 8.3 has a more recent 6.0 Marshmallow version while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E has Android 4.1. The LG G Pad X 8.3 is a a lot newer and somewhat thinner tablet than the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, although it is also a little heavier.

The LG G Pad X 8.3 features just a little better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because although it has doesn't have an additional graphics co-processor, it also counts with more RAM and a higher number of cores. LG G Pad X 8.3 has just a bit better looking screen than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has a bigger display, a lot greater screen density and a much higher resolution of 1080 x 1920px.

LG G Pad X 8.3 counts with a much better storage to store more apps and games than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has more internal storage and a slot for an SD memory card that supports a maximum of 128 GB. LG G Pad X 8.3 counts with improved battery performance than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has 4800mAh of battery capacity instead of 4000mAh.

LG G Pad X 8.3 shoots better pictures and videos than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has a lot higher resolution back facing camera and a way higher video definition.
